These are the most common places where auto accidents tend to happen:

Close to the Driver’s Home

According to the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ration (NHTSA), most car accidents take place within five miles of the victim’s residence, and most fatal accidents happen within 25 miles of the home. This is because of various factors, including the following:

  • Frequency: You drive more in your local area, and even your neighborhood, than anywhere else. Therefore, the chances of experiencing a crash are higher. 
  • Attentiveness: Another reason car accidents occur near home is drivers pay less attention while driving in a familiar place. Your brain is on autopilot. The tendency to use muscle memory rather than vigilance or be on full alert reduces your ability to react to something unexpected.
  • Inexperience: Less experienced, younger drivers generally stay close to home. Restrictions on where, when, and how far they can drive aim to keep it this way and improve safety. However, it also means younger drivers are more likely to be in a car accident in their neighborhood.

Your Route on a Daily Commute

Commuters in Los Angeles are stuck in traffic for hours each day. They’re often strapped for time from when they wake up to when their workday starts. Many people resort to multitasking behind the wheel. Aside from being frustrated and exhausted, commuters may eat, shave, or put on makeup while driving in stop-and-go traffic. Other contributing factors during rush hour include speeding, recklessness, and inexperienced drivers.

Intersections

Intersections are a common place for car crashes. Drivers may be unaware of or react slowly to traffic lights and stop signs. Defective signals can also contribute to accidents. Intersections are conducive environments to collisions because vehicles must cross paths from different directions. A driver failing to yield the right of way increases the risk of an accident. Parking Lots

Car accidents are common in parking lots. A variety of factors contribute to the increased risk, including having to navigate compact spaces and drivers competing for limited spaces and being stressed out. Most parking lot accidents are low-speed, so they rarely cause serious injuries. However, costly repairs may result from backing up into another vehicle, getting clipped by another car, or a vehicle being sideswiped by another driver while they’re parking.

Rural Areas

It would seem logical for most accidents to occur in crowded cities. However, more accidents are reported on rural roads. There are also more fatalities. Some of the reasons may include higher speed limits and fewer police patrols compared to urban areas. Poor lighting, two-lane roads, and few barriers to prevent crashes or animals from running on roads are also contributing factors.

Construction Zones

Car accidents are common in construction zones because inattentive drivers have little time to take action when approaching the area. Rear-end accidents are common where there’s a lane closure or a driver must navigate a road shoulder. The victims of road construction crashes are often construction workers and police officers.

Are Car Accidents More Likely at a Certain Time?

Regardless of location, vehicular accidents are more likely to occur on the weekend or late afternoons during work days. The incidence of car crashes increases at times when people are rushing to get home or are fatigued. High-volume traffic, urgency to return home from work, and picking up kids are factors that lead to more accidents in a variety of places. Car accidents are also more frequent during holidays, including July 4th, Memorial Day Weekend, and Thanksgiving.
